Idiot wears anti-TSA tee, is outraged when TSA detains him

8/22/2012

Arijit Guha would've flown out of Buffalo Niagara International Airport on Saturday morning, but his T-shirt kept him from being allowed on the flight. Guha thought it would be a great idea to wear a TSA-baiting tee that featured the phrases " BOMBS ZOMG" and "GONNA KILL US ALL," a wardrobe choice that reportedly "made numerous passengers and employees nervous." After being pulled aside, he told TSA agents that he was "mocking the security theater charade … that we're seeing right now." He was detained, questioned and rebooked on a flight the next day, while simultaneously tweeting about the "racist dingdongs" and "meatheads" he was dealing with.
